Summary: Something strange is hapening in the garden. Moa is munching melons in the moonlight, Laughing Owl hoots happily, Huia are eating grubs in the hibiscus tree ... and thats just the start as creatures that have disappeared from modern Aotearoa reappear and have fun in the night. Includes information on extinct species from New Zealand. (Publisher)
In English and Te Reo Māori
